Gnocchi
Ingredients
(Makes about 1.4 Lbs of gnocchi)
1 Lb potatoes
1 1/2 cups flour
1 beaten egg yolk
Salt and pepper to taste
Olive oil
Rosemary (optional)
Instructions
1 - Boil the potatoes with their skin in a large pot and cook until soft (about 15-20 minutes).
2 - Drain.
3 - Allow to cool then remove the skin and mash the potatoes.
4 - In the bowl of a stand mixer, mix together the mashed potatoes, egg, salt and pepper.
5 - Gradually add the flour and beat until dough comes together. (If the dough is too soft, add flour 1 Tbsp at a time).
6 - Form a thick rectangle, wrap in plastic wrap and place it in the fridge for 30 minutes.
7 - On a floured table, cut dough into stripes and roll cylinders. Cut the cylinders into even pieces to make the gnocchi.
8 - Leave a print on the gnocchi by gently rolling and pushing down on the back of a fork. (Optional).
9 - Boil water in a pot with salt. Throw the gnocchi in the water a handful at a time and cook until they come to the surface (about 2 minutes).
10 - Scoop the gnocchi out and transfer to a colander previously placed on a bowl. Then, transfer to a bowl and add olive oil so the gnocchi won't stick to each other.
11 - Once all the gnocchi are cooked, heat a frying pan with olive oil and sauté them with fresh rosemary, or enjoy with tomato sauce, cheese sauce, pesto, boeuf bourguignon, garlic and mushrooms...
